Here are a few pointers to help students answer the test paper more effectively:

1- Write as much as necessary – Students frequently overwrite in exams, believing their educators will give them extra points based solely on the magnitude of the answer. This is only sometimes the case. The reliability of the answer is what teachers look for in answers, not the length.

2- Maintain answer structures – When attempting the questions on the test paper, the revision test should ensure that the answers follow a good structure. The answer will look better if the information is not distributed and is well organized.
